Rosh Hashanah (Yom Teruah) is a public holiday in Israel, observed on September 28, 2030 (Saturday) in 2030. As an official public holiday, most government offices, banks, and schools are closed.
In 2030, Rosh Hashanah (Yom Teruah) falls on a Saturday, which is already part of the weekend.
